BIG SPOILER WARNING if you haven't read Wicked the novel and seen the stage show.
For instance, and the Wizard of Oz ends the Wicked Witch of the West (or Elphaba as she's know in Wicked) dying because Dorothy killed her because she wanted to go home. In Wicked the novel, Elphaba dies at the end because Dorothy throws a bucket of water over her because Elphaba's dress is on fire, and Dorothy doesn't know the Elphaba's allergic to water. In Wicked the musical, Elphaba doesn't die, she escapes through a trap door when Dorothy throws the water over her and escapes to another country (presumably) with Fiyero. Fiyero's storylines differ in the two Wicked's as well - will he choose Glinda or Elphie for instance. I guess it's only if you're a huge fan that you'd know all the story lines though.

Writing Reg, I think that you must have gotten sims that use a non-default skintone. The creator of the mod that makes non-default skins possible clearly states that it is not a good idea to share sims with a non-default skintone. Since LadyFrontBum makes both non-default and default versions of her skintones, the sim creator may have been confused. There's probably a cheat that would allow you to edit a sim in CAS, but I don't know what it is. I just use Twallan's computer. You really shouldn't have a problem if they only use default replacements, but maybe something changed with the last patch. Personally, I almost never download sims, it's much more fun to make them.
There are now short sliders too, check the relevant threads over at MTS. Look for jonha, they've been doing lots of stuff with sliders. Sharing sims that have been made with custom sliders shouldn't cause any problems, but they will snap back to default if they are edited in CAS.
